October 12, 2010 Report: Wall Street Pay to Hit Record $144B ------------------------------------------- A new study says Wall Street pay is set to break a record high for the second consecutive year. According to the Wall Street Journal, the top thirty-five financial firms are on pace to hand out $144 billion in compensation and benefits this year—a four percent increase from 2009. Total profits are estimated at $63.1 billion, a 20 percent decline from 2006. .
